Technical Field
The utility model belongs to the technical field related to building construction equipment, and particularly relates to a concrete pouring auxiliary device for building construction.
Background
Concrete is a gel material which is prepared by mixing cement, sand and stone as aggregates with water according to a certain proportion and then stirring, and the concrete is widely applied to civil engineering; in the construction, the in-process is pour to the large tracts of land concrete beam board, needs the manual work to promote to pour the pipe and carries out the work of pouring, because pour the pipe when pouring, can produce certain reaction force, so at the in-process of pouring, will waste staff's physical power, but also cause the staff to tumble easily.

The working principle and the using process of the utility model are as follows: after the device is installed, a worker firstly puts the whole device at a position to be poured, then fixedly connects the fixed circular tube 12 in the sliding copper tube mechanism 1 with a pouring tube in a concrete pouring machine, and after the worker finishes the work, the worker pushes the support upright posts 21 in the two ball type support columns 2 to enable the plurality of balls 23 to rotate and move on the inner wall of the convex anti-falling chute 31, so that the two ball type support columns 2 move left and right along the fixed bottom column 3, and simultaneously pulls the fixed circular tube 12 to enable the cross through hole slide block 11 to move back and forth in the cross anti-falling chute 51, so that the fixed circular tube 12 can better pour, and simultaneously, the physical strength of the worker can be saved in the pouring process, and also avoids the falling phenomenon of the staff, thereby avoiding the staff from being injured.
